Dipping active Covid cases; 76 pc of active cases in 10 most affected states

New Delhi, Sep 30 (UNI) Active cases have less than halved in two months from 33.32 per cent on August 1 to 15.11 per cent on Wednesday, as the total number of positive cases of the country rose to 9,40,441.
Of the 80,472 new confirmed cases recorded in past 24 hours, 76 per cent of them are from 10 states and UTs.
Maharashtra has contributed the maximum to the new cases with nearly 15,000 cases followed by Karnataka with more than 10,000 cases. 1,179 case fatalities have been reported in the past 24 hours.
